#sweeps_fade_site_to_white{display:none;position:absolute;height:1000px;width:100%;z-index:20000;top:0;left:0;bottom:0;right:0;background-image:url(http://pics.bluenile.com/assets/images/pxl.gif);}#sweeps_popup{position:absolute;top:170px;left:5%;width:352px;border:2px solid #003366;z-index:300000;background:#FFFFFF url(http://pics.bluenile.com/assets/chrome/bg/opt-in-overlay-bg.jpg) repeat-x top left;padding:1px;}#sweeps_popup_inner{border:1px solid #FFFFFF;}#sweeps_container{padding:4px 4px 4px 18px;}#sweeps_form{margin:0;padding:0;}#sweeps_form_basic{width:328px;}#sweeps_rules_container{color:#666666;font-size:10px;padding:12px 0 8px 0;text-align:center;}#sweeps_rules_container div{padding:5px 0 0 0;}#sweeps_close_x{display:inline;float:right;margin:4px 4px 0;text-align:right;width:20px;}#sweeps_pop_header{display:inline;float:left;margin:18px 13px 0 0;width:218px;}#sweeps_pop_hero{float:left;margin-top:8px;width:73px;}#sweeps_intro{margin-top:7px;}.sweeps_pop_text{color:#003366;font-family:Verdana,sans-serif;font-size:10px;font-weight:bold;margin-bottom:22px;}#sweeps_page_email_subscribe, #sweeps_page_birthdate, #sweeps_page_weddingdate, #sweeps_page_weddingdate_2{color:#666666;}#sweeps_email_subscribe{border:1px solid #003366;font-size:10px;margin-bottom:22px;padding:2px 0 3px;width:189px;}#sweeps_popup #lb_sweeps_email_subscribe{width:40px;}#sweeps_weddingdate_container_engaged, #sweeps_weddingdate_container_married{display:none;}#sweeps_weddingdate_container .date_menu, #sweeps_weddingdate_container_2 .date_menu, #sweeps_birthdatedate_container .date_menu{font:10px verdana;color:#666666;}#sweeps_popup .rules_link{font-size:9px;}#sweeps_popup .required{color:#990000;margin-right:2px;font-size:9px;}#sweeps_popup label{color:#666666;display:block;float:left;font-size:10px;font-family:Verdana,sans-serif;margin:0;padding:3px 5px 10px 0;text-align:right;width:108px;}#sweeps_popup select{border:1px solid #003366;color:#666666;font-size:10px;margin-bottom:8px;width:50px;}#sweeps_popup select.sweeps_wide_menu{width:158px;}#sweeps_popup option{color:#666666;}#sweeps_popup .subscribe{color:#666666;font-family:Verdana,sans-serif;font-size:10px;}#sweeps_popup .error{color:#990000;}#sweeps_popup .txt_input{width:140px;font-family:Verdana, sans-serif;}#sweeps_popup .instructions{margin:0 0 10px 0;color:#003366;}#sweeps_popup #sweeps_submit_button{border:0;}#sweeps_popup a{color:#006699;}#sweeps_close_x{cursor:pointer;}.sweeps_button{background:url("http://pics.bluenile.com/assets/chrome/bg/opt-in-overlay-submit.gif") no-repeat top left;border:medium none;color:#fff;cursor:pointer;display:inline;float:right;font-size:10px;height:22px;margin-right:8px;padding:0;width:68px;}#sweeps_popup .fieldset{margin-bottom:20px;}#sweeps_popup .required_note{float:left;padding-top:7px;}#sweeps_thank_you_entering{color:#666666;height:85px;}
